    Damien Molony: A Rising Star in Television and Theater

    Damien Molony is a name that has steadily gained recognition and acclaim in the world of television and theater. With his impressive range, captivating presence, and dedication to his craft, Molony has carved out a unique niche for himself. This article delves into his career, exploring the roles that have defined him and the journey that has led him to become one of the most promising actors of his generation.

    Early Life and Education

    Born on February 21, 1984, in Johnstown Bridge, County Kildare, Ireland, Damien Molony developed an interest in acting at a young age. His passion for performance led him to pursue formal education in the arts. He attended Drama Centre London, one of the most prestigious acting schools in the UK, where he honed his skills and prepared for a career on stage and screen.

    Breakthrough Role in “Being Human”

    Molony’s breakout role came in 2011 when he was cast as Hal Yorke in the popular BBC Three series “Being Human.” The show, which revolved around supernatural beings living together and trying to maintain their humanity, provided the perfect platform for Molony to showcase his talents. As Hal, a vampire struggling with his dark past and striving to remain good, Molony brought a depth and complexity to the character that resonated with audiences. His performance earned him critical praise and a loyal fan base, setting the stage for future success.

    Success on the Stage

    In addition to his television work, Molony has a rich background in theater. His stage career began with notable performances in productions such as “Tis Pity She’s a Whore” at the West Yorkshire Playhouse and “Travelling Light” at the National Theatre. His versatility as an actor was evident in his ability to tackle a wide range of roles, from classic literature to contemporary drama.

    One of Molony’s standout performances was in the play “The Hard Problem” by Tom Stoppard, staged at the National Theatre in 2015. The play, which deals with the complexities of human consciousness and morality, required a nuanced and intellectual approach. Molony’s portrayal of the character Spike was both compelling and thought-provoking, demonstrating his capacity to engage with challenging material.

    Diversifying Roles and Expanding Horizons

    Following his success in “Being Human,” Molony continued to take on diverse roles in television. He appeared in the critically acclaimed series “Ripper Street” as DC Albert Flight, a character that further showcased his ability to navigate complex narratives and historical settings. His performance in “Suspects,” a procedural crime drama, highlighted his adaptability and commitment to realism in his acting.

    In 2016, Molony joined the cast of the popular series “Crashing,” created by and starring Phoebe Waller-Bridge. The show, which explores the lives of a group of twenty-somethings living in a disused hospital, allowed Molony to flex his comedic muscles. His role as Anthony, a conflicted and endearing character, added a new dimension to his repertoire and demonstrated his versatility.

    “The Split” and Continuing Success

    One of Molony’s most notable recent roles has been in the BBC legal drama “The Split.” The series, which focuses on the lives and careers of a family of female divorce lawyers, features Molony as Tyler Donaghue, a charming and enigmatic character who becomes involved with one of the main protagonists. His performance in “The Split” has been praised for its depth and charisma, further cementing his status as a talented and dynamic actor.

    FAQs

    Who is Damien Molony?

    Damien Molony is an Irish actor known for his work in television, theater, and film. He gained prominence for his role as Hal Yorke in the BBC Three series “Being Human” and has since appeared in a variety of other notable projects, including “Ripper Street,” “Crashing,” and “The Split.”

    When and where was Damien Molony born?

    Damien Molony was born on February 21, 1984, in Johnstown Bridge, County Kildare, Ireland.

    What is Damien Molony’s educational background?

    Molony trained at Drama Centre London, one of the UK’s most prestigious acting schools, where he received formal education in acting and honed his craft.

    What are some of Damien Molony’s most famous roles?

    Hal Yorke in “Being Human”: A vampire struggling with his dark past and trying to maintain his humanity.

    DC Albert Flight in “Ripper Street”: A detective in the historical crime drama.

    Anthony in “Crashing”: A conflicted character in the comedy-drama series created by Phoebe Waller-Bridge.

    Tyler Donaghue in “The Split”: A charming and enigmatic character in the BBC legal drama.

    Has Damien Molony appeared in theater productions?

    Yes, Damien Molony has an extensive theater background. Some of his notable stage performances include:

    “Tis Pity She’s a Whore” at the West Yorkshire Playhouse.

    “Travelling Light” at the National Theatre.

    “The Hard Problem” by Tom Stoppard, also at the National Theatre.

    What awards or nominations has Damien Molony received?

    While Damien Molony has not yet won any major awards, he has received critical acclaim for his performances, particularly for his role in “Being Human” and his work on stage.
